X-RAY DIFFRACTION

Crystallization Details
Method pH Temprature Details
X-RAY DIFFRACTION 7.5 292 0.1M Hepes pH 7.5, 10% isopropanol, 20% PEG 4000, VAPOR DIFFUSION, HANGING DROP, temperature 292K
Unit Cell:
a: 84.517 Å b: 84.517 Å c: 144.637 Å α: 90.00° β: 90.00° γ: 120.00°
Symmetry:
Space Group: P 65
Crystal Properties:
Matthew's Coefficient: 2.66 Solvent Content: 53.79
